Job Description

GENERAL DESCRIPTION The Sheltering Case Manager will work with moderate to high needs clients to support and guide them through an extended level of assistance in order to remove barriers and facilitate stable housing. The person in this position will perform eligibility screening program enrollment participant follow-ups process required paperwork data entry and other program supports. This position will directly align with the Housing First initiatives of the ARCHES Project. The position is renewable annually based on continuation of project funding.M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ge skill and/or ability required.E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CETwo years of related social service experience direct client care; or an acceptable equivalent combination of education and experience. Ideal candidates will posses an advanced degree with two or more years of homeless service delivery experience and mental health certifications and or licensing.CERTIFICATES LISCENSE REGISTRATIONSKnowledge of/ or experience with: the principles or coordinated assessment working with unsheltered or vulnerable populations as well as best practices in homeless service delivery is preferred. Basic Proficiencies in computers MS Office products database software and web tools.Must posses excellent planning organization and time management skillsAbility to effectively communicate both orally and in written form.PHYSICAL AND MENTAL DEMANDS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ential duties and responsibilities.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ision and ability to adjust focus. Frequently required to hear and speak.Frequently lift up to 25 pounds. Occasionally lift up to 50 pounds.Manual dexterity for handling computers devices and office equipment.Mobility within shelters and grounds and officesIncidental driving tasks may be requested for employees with a personal vehicle and proof of current auto insurance. Maintains calm disposition when clients or others may become de-escalation applying crisis intervention and de-escalation techniques for all participants.WORK ENVIRONMENTIndoor work environment with frequent interruptions and demands.Occasional outdoor environment including perimeter monitoring. Occasional urgent situations requiring law enforcement involvement and/or paramedic professionals.Close quarters often with a client population experiencing homelessness substance use disorders and/or sever and persistent mental illness and/or predictable behavior. Exposure to trash bodily fluids and malodorous air. Ability to work outside of normal business hours including nights weekends and holidays.
